Distance from Jeddah Airport to Mecca

The distance from Jeddah Airport to Mecca is about 96 kilometers, which is roughly 60 miles. Normally, you can make the trip in around 1 hour and 15 minutes. However, if you’re traveling during busy times like Ramadan or Hajj, you might find yourself on the road for up to two hours because of heavy traffic.

Comparing Transport Options for Jeddah Airport to Mecca

Mode of Transport Avg. Cost (SAR) Duration Best For
Taxi / Private Car
250-400
1-1.5 hrs
Comfort & convenience
Train
60-100
30-45 mins
Speed & reliability
Bus
30-40
1.5-2 hrs
Budget travel
Private Van
300-600
1-1.5 hrs
Families & groups

For Budget-Conscious Pilgrims

Traveling on a budget? Think about taking an Umrah bus or the Haramain train. These options are not only wallet-friendly but also safe and are gaining popularity among pilgrims. The bus service connects key routes between Jeddah, Mecca, and Madinah at set prices, making it a convenient choice.

For Families and Groups

If you’re traveling with kids or older family members, look into private transport like vans, SUVs, or minibuses. They provide room, flexibility, and direct transfers, making the journey smoother. Many transport companies in Saudi Arabia offer family packages and experienced drivers who can assist you throughout the trip.

For Fast and Comfortable Travel

Short on time or craving comfort? The train from Jeddah Airport to Mecca is your best bet. It’s the quickest and most reliable option, with ticket prices ranging from SAR 60 to 100. You can skip traffic jams and relax in a clean, air-conditioned cabin while enjoying your ride.

Tips for Umrah Transport from Jeddah Airport to Mecca

  1. Plan Ahead: If you’re traveling during Ramadan or Hajj, it’s a good idea to arrange your transport early. Taxis and buses tend to get booked up fast during these busy times.
  2. Confirm Prices: Before you hop into a taxi from Jeddah airport to Mecca, always check the fare upfront. This will help you avoid any surprise charges.
  3. Know Your Train Schedule: The Haramain Railway runs on a fixed timetable. It’s important to keep track of your train times, as missing your train could make you late.
